biofood books are an excellent way to introduce young children to the concept of healthy eating and the importance of making good food choices. By incorporating colorful illustrations and engaging stories, these books make learning about nutrition fun and exciting for kids. When it comes to selecting biofood books for six-year-olds, look for titles that are age-appropriate and easy to understand. These books should teach children about the benefits of eating f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and other nutritious foods. They can also help children develop an understanding of where food comes from and how it affects their bodies. Some popular biofood books for young children include "The Very Hungry Caterpillar" by Eric Carle, which follows the journey of a caterpillar as it eats its way through various foods before transforming into a butterfly. Another great option is "Eating the Alphabet" by Lois Ehlert, which introduces children to a wide variety of fruits and vegetables through colorful illustrations. Reading biofood books with your six-year-old can help foster a love of healthy eating and encourage them to make positive food choices. Plus, it's a great way to spend quality time together while promoting a lifelong appreciation for nutritious foods.
